2-20-14 – Glenn Beck got really fired up today over a proposed FCC plan to study newsrooms, going off on a fiery rant on how press freedom is being throttled in the U.S. and finding it beyond stunning that hardly anyone is talking about the study.  Beck called this “one of the most disturbing stories I have ever heard in my entire broadcast career,” crying, “You cannot allow the federal government into your local newsrooms!”

And to bolster his argument that the press is becoming less independent, Beck touted Robin Wright’s comments that a senior Obama official told her the press is literally in bed with sources. Beck reminded his audience that the press “used to be adversaries,” but now the media and political elites have teamed up to lecture the public about what they need to know.

“You are a worthless worm! You are too stupid to understand! The press understands because they’re the educated elite! And they will take the marching orders from the people who speak at the Council of Foreign Relations!”

Beck was stunned that the U.S. only ranks 46th in press freedom around the world, saying, “America, you better wake up now.”
